Beautiful collector's plate from The Hamilton Collection showing Lisa Danielle's A Mile in His Moccasins .
 
Determined to obtain better living conditions for his people, the great Sioux chief, American Horse, traveled to Washington in 1891 and successfully pleaded their cause in the white man's world. Though the miles have taken their toll on the delicate porcupine-quill decoration, the bead work borders, even the very seams and soles, their luminous beauty shines through. Maintaining our individual dignity while pursuing harmony with our brother takes an eagle's strength, but great are the rewards for all who are willing to walk a mile in another's moccasins.
